IDPH Press Release -- 8/31/2009
IDPH Subject of Internet Rumor
Department issues clarification
The Iowa Department of Public Health (IDPH) has learned a copy of Iowa's "Facility Quarantine Order" template is being circulated on the Internet. It is not known who accessed this document. To ensure there is no confusion on this issue, IDPH wants to make it clear that Iowa has not issued any isolation and quarantine orders for novel influenza A (H1N1), and has no plans to issue any this fall.

In preparation for public health emergencies, these types of templates are often prepared in case they are needed, but isolation and quarantine orders are only very rarely used in very specific situations.
